How Our Floodwater Removal Process Works
Our process starts with a thorough assessment of your property to find out the extent of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the floodwater and develop a customized plan to remove it. Our team will then use advanced equipment to extract the water, and our technicians will work to dry and dehumidify the affected areas. We’ll also document the damage to ensure a smooth insurance claims process.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will assess the damage and develop a customized plan to remove the floodwater. We’ll identify the source of the water and find out the best course of action.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a successful restoration process.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use advanced equipment to extract the floodwater from your property. We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ove the water quickly and efficiently. This step is critical in pre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ected areas. We’ll use desiccants and d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ture and prevent further damage. This step is essential in pre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Documentation and Claims
Our team will document the damage and work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process. We’ll provide detailed photos and reports to support your claim. This step is crucial in ensuring you receive the compensation you deserve.

Floodwater Removal Cost in Chillum, MD
The cost of floodwater removal var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Chillum, MD. These are estimates, not guarantees.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area and severity of the damage.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area and type of equipment needed. |
| Documentation and claims |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of the claim and number of photos and reports required. |
